Outline of Final Research Achievements

The researcher implemented several studies to examine different aspects of tourism impacts, focusing on the psychological impacts of tourism. They explored these issues not only in Japan but also in Vietnam to expand their understanding. The researcher published their results as journal papers, book chapters, conference proceeding chapters, and conference presentations. They are using this knowledge in teaching and doing other research.

Academic Significance and Societal Importance of the Research Achievements

This project helps expand the knowledge of tourism impacts by including psychological issues. Its outcomes are applied to teaching tourism issues at universities in Japan and Vietnam.
